Transaction ef07597cfe111de73c5bcf5098289b2b05d5deea10016d4d2d5ed30eb7b52d2c

3 Input
2 Outputs
  • ef07597cfe111de73c5bcf5098289b2b05d5deea10016d4d2d5ed30eb7b52d2c:0
  • value  10000000
    address  1HXTrHHLj3EKm3NJXcaJpmXJhyMdaUEhW5
  • ef07597cfe111de73c5bcf5098289b2b05d5deea10016d4d2d5ed30eb7b52d2c:1
  • value  1513006
    address  16HAGK5iwwgRNfGputN4Ww3D36Len31iSU